How to Make Homemade Strawberry Cake with Lemon Frosting

Step 1: Preparation

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ease and flour two 9-inch round cake pans. This will ensure your cakes come out smoothly without sticking.

Step 2: Mixing

In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y. Incorporate the eggs one at a time, making sure to mix well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ract and the fresh strawberry puree for that delightful fruity flavor.

Step 3: Cooking

In another b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t. Gradually add this dry mixture to the butter mixture alternately with the milk, starting and ending with the flour. Mix just until combined to avoid overmixing. Divide the batter evenly between the prepared cake pans. Bake for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. After baking, let the cakes cool in the pans for about 10 minutes before turning them out onto wire racks to cool completely.

Step 4: Finishing

While the cakes cool, prepare the lemon frosting. In a mixing bowl, beat together the softened butter and powdered sugar until creamy. Then, incorporate the lemon juice and lemon zest into the mixture until it becomes smooth and spreadable. Once the cakes have completely cooled, spread a generous layer of lemon frosting between the layers and on the top and sides of the cake. If desired, decorate with fresh strawberries for an extra pop of color and taste.

How to Store Homemade Strawberry Cake with Lemon Frosting

To store the cake, keep it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will stay fresh for about 3-4 days. If the room temperature is warm, refrigerate the cake to prevent the frosting from melting. You can also freeze slices by wrapping them tightly in plastic wrap and then in foil; they will last for up to three months in the freezer.

Expert Tips for Perfect Homemade Strawberry Cake with Lemon Frosting

  • When pureeing strawberries, ensure you use fresh, ripe strawberries for the best flavor.
  • Adjust the amount of lemon juice in the frosting if you prefer a less tangy taste.
  • For extra moisture, try adding a bit of yogurt to the batter.
  • Always allow the cake layers to cool completely before frosting to avoid melting the frosting.
  • If you want a more intense strawberry flavor, consider adding some freeze-dried strawberries into the batter.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can I use frozen strawberries instead of fresh? Yes, you can use frozen strawberries. Just thaw and drain them well before pureeing. The texture may be slightly different, but they will still taste delicious.
  • What can I substitute for all-purpose flour? You may substitute with almond flour or a gluten-free flour blend, but the texture might vary.
  • How can I make the cake less sweet? Reduce the sugar in the cake batter and the frosting to taste. You can also add more lemon juice for a tangy balance.
  • Can I make this cake ahead of time? Absolutely! You can bake and frost the cake a day in advance. Just store it properly in the refrigerator.
  • Is it possible to make cupcakes with this batter? Yes! You can use this recipe to make delicious cupcakes. Just adjust the baking time to about 18-20 minutes.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ups fresh strawberries, pureed
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up milk
  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 1/4 cup l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ease and flour two 9-inch round cake pans.
  2. C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
  3. Incorporate the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ract and fresh strawberry puree.
  4. Wh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t in another bowl.
  5. Gradually add the dry mixture to the butter mixture alternately with the milk, starting and ending with the flour.
  6. Mix just until combined to avoid overmixing.
  7. Divide the batter evenly between the prepared cake pans.
  8. Bake for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  9. While the cakes cool, prepare the lemon frosting by beating together the softened butter and powdered sugar until creamy.
  10. Incorporate the lemon juice and lemon zest until smooth and spreadable.
  11. Once the cakes have cooled completely, spread a generous layer of lemon frosting between the layers and on the top and sides of the cake.
